The Forge, a community website for the promotion and creation of creator-owned role-playing games, is about celebrate the second birthday of its newest incarnation. On April 3, 2001, our forums opened for business under the direction of our administrators, Ron Edwards and Clinton R. Nixon, and have been an active site for role-playing game creation on the Internet ever since, with great games like Dust Devils, Trollbabe, Universalis, Donjon, and The Pool emerging from discussions there.

For four days, from April 3 to April 7, 2003, we’re letting our hair down. With a special, no-registration-needed, all-topics-open Birthday Forum, we invite anyone who has ever been interested in the Forge or role-playing game creation to come, ask questions, and celebrate with us.
